How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Actually Works
The process of dishwasher leak water removal may seem daunting, but trust us, it’s not. Our team has perfected a method that’s both efficient and effective. We’ll work quickly to extract the water, dry your home, and restore your belongings – all without cutting corners or compromising on quality.
Step 1: Water Extraction
Our technicians will arrive at your home within 60 minutes, equipped with top-of-the-line equ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age. They’ll work efficiently to remove all standing water, making sure to dry all surfaces and belongings.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, our team will use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your home. This step is crucial in preventing mold and further damage.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your home is dry,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 4: Restoration and Repair
Finally, our team will work with you to restore your belongings and repair any damaged areas of your home. This may include replacing drywall, flooring, or other structural elements.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Cost In Westminster, MD
The cost of dishwasher leak water removal can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Westminster, MD. These are just estimates, and the actual cost may be higher or lower.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Type of surfaces affected and level of contamination |
| Restoration and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Scope of repairs and type of materials needed |

Will I need to replace my dishwasher?
Not necessarily. If the damage is limited to the dishwasher’s water supply lines or hoses, we may be able to repair or replace those parts without replacing the entire dishwasher.
How do I prevent dishwasher leak water damage in the future?
To prevent dishwasher leak water damage, make sure to regularly check your dishwasher’s water supply lines and hoses for signs of wear or damage. You should also consider installing a water leak detection system in your home.
